About ethyl 2-[(4,5-dimethoxy-2-methylphenyl)sulfonylamino]-1,3-oxazole-4-carboxylate
ethyl 2-[(4,5-dimethoxy-2-methylphenyl)sulfonylamino]-1,3-oxazole-4-carboxylate (PubChem CID 71857793) has the molecular formula C15H18N2O7S
and a molecular weight of 370.38 g/mol. Its IUPAC name is ethyl 2-[(4,5-dimethoxy-2-methylphenyl)sulfonylamino]-1,3-oxazole-4-carboxylate.

What is the SMILES notation for ethyl 2-[(4,5-dimethoxy-2-methylphenyl)sulfonylamino]-1,3-oxazole-4-carboxylate?
The canonical SMILES for ethyl 2-[(4,5-dimethoxy-2-methylphenyl)sulfonylamino]-1,3-oxazole-4-carboxylate is CCOC(=O)c1coc(NS(=O)(=O)c2cc(OC)c(OC)cc2C)n1.
What is the InChIKey of ethyl 2-[(4,5-dimethoxy-2-methylphenyl)sulfonylamino]-1,3-oxazole-4-carboxylate?
The InChIKey is FJZRHLTVKHRSPV-UHFFFAOYSA-N. The full InChI is InChI=1S/C15H18N2O7S/c1-5-23-14(18)10-8-24-15(16-10)17-25(19,20)13-7-12(22-4)11(21-3)6-9(13)2/h6-8H,5H2,1-4H3,(H,16,17).
What are the key properties of ethyl 2-[(4,5-dimethoxy-2-methylphenyl)sulfonylamino]-1,3-oxazole-4-carboxylate?
ethyl 2-[(4,5-dimethoxy-2-methylphenyl)sulfonylamino]-1,3-oxazole-4-carboxylate has a molecular weight of 370.38 g/mol, XLogP of 1.98, 7 rotatable bonds, 1 hydrogen bond donors, and 8 hydrogen bond acceptors.
